The compact rooms can be arranged vertically, separated or framed as individual scenes.

The easiest option is to separate the companion lab from the main room and place it on a small riser. The two scenes remain visually connected but no longer compete for the same depth.

Treat the set as a collection of scenes

A deeper shelf can use a diagonal arrangement, with one corner of the main model pointing forward. This exposes more interior detail and leaves a natural space for the minifigures.

For the smallest display area, focus on one wall and rotate the scene periodically. The set contains enough recognisable props that a partial view still communicates the subject clearly.
